ATTRACTIONS / ATRACCIONES

Zacatecas, The historic silver city and the gate to the Mexican colonial cities.
With its Historical heritage, the city of Zacatecas is seen to have &quot,The Face of a quarry, but a heart of silver&quot,. Some of Mexico's finest buildings, including perhaps its most stunning Catedral, all built from the riches of the local silver mines, cluster along narrow, winding streets at the foot of a spectacular rock-topped hill called Cerro de la Bufa. This historic city has much to detain you, from trips into an old silver mine to some excellent museums and the ascent of la Bufa itself by cablecar. In 1993 UNESCO, acknowledging the city as a place of exceptional interest and universal value declared the city's colonial core a &quot,World Heritage Zone&quot,.
